Barcelona have not ended the 2021/22 league season on the high note that Xavi wanted. Villarreal ended a series of 27 failures to beat the Catalans across all competitions to claim a 2-0 win at Camp Nou.

The visitors took the lead on 41 minutes when Alfonso Pedraza was played into space down the left and stroked the ball past Ter Stegen

But in a peculiar match, the goals came utterly against the run of play.

There was certainly a sense of going through the motions in this one, but while Barça had nothing but honour to play for, which did seem to take the spark of urgency out of their game, Villarreal were chasing European football. And yet from start to finish it was the men in blaugrana shirts who were taking all the initiative.

Before Pedraza’s goal, Barca had been mastering the possession and all of the meaningful football had been played in the yellow half of the pitch, but all it produced was a long series of half-chances, with Ferran Torres particularly in on the action.

None of those were taken and as Barca pushed forward more and more there was always the niggling danger that Villarreal might catch them on the counter… And that’s exactly what happened in the build-up to goal number one.

For the remainder of the game, there was only one other moment when Unai Emery’s side looked even closing to scoring, and that was the one that put them 2-0 on top.
